Multisource Heterogeneous Data-Based Behavior Excavation of Investors and Financial Risk Prediction
Pijie Feng and
Zaoli Yang
Mathematical Problems in Engineering, 2022, vol. 2022, 1-9
Abstract:
The investment decision-making behavior of investors refers to the capital purchase behavior of investors in order to achieve a certain purpose or goal. As an individual decision-maker, investors will be affected by various factors when making investment decisions, and the influencing factors may be caused by the outside or generated by themselves. The focus of this paper is to analyze the impact of investors’ past returns on investors’ decision-making based on multisource heterogeneous data. Multisource heterogeneous data can show the results of investors’ behavior evaluation at multiscale and multilevel. Using conceptual deduction and empirical research methods, based on the analysis of investors’ behavior, the financial risk prediction results are proposed. Financial risk prediction mainly analyzes the impact of investment returns on investors’ decision-making from two aspects: individual returns and overall returns. The measurement indicators of investment decisions use investors’ transaction frequency and asset size.
